Washington, DC, July 27, 1998 — The Competitive Enterprise Institute (CEI) released today the results of a poll conducted last week in Albuquerque by Rasmussen Research. The poll asked 500 Albuquerque adults their opinion on Social Security reform and had a margin of error of 4.5%. The results reveal a clear message: "Reform Social Security Now."
"These results are consistent with what people are saying all over the country," commented Tom Miller, Director of Economic Studies at CEI. "We need to reform Social Security now and stop jeopardizing our children’s future."
Currently, CEI is running radio and print ads in Albuquerque alerting people to the importance of reforming Social Security now. The radio ads, featuring the "Social Security bus", run through tomorrow and the print ad is in today’s Albuquerque Journal and Tribune.
